Output d958880bce5759419b0c7637f416f1279de4eb7d6a0b941525450a0b4140453b:1

value
3061100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e39cf889c049c609af39cfc9c10069b29ecb0ce OP_EQUAL
address
3BjqWQEhyrAebjkFsTefbS2owNXJjRn1pS
transaction
d958880bce5759419b0c7637f416f1279de4eb7d6a0b941525450a0b4140453b